Output 8ec37bef7b995cbe023f860ea854077fcdb16f5dd6c30edf9d27a269e881b3e5:89

value
36660
script pubkey
OP_0 OP_PUSHBYTES_20 3c1b521cced5b5a4c707e7a6abaef225684b4386
address
bc1q8sd4y8xw6k66f3c8u7n2hthjy45yksux9c2lnr
transaction
8ec37bef7b995cbe023f860ea854077fcdb16f5dd6c30edf9d27a269e881b3e5
spent
true